Output 3098c8805946598bcf280e68434cd9c2d554d85455edb789089fa8211d0e028a:2

value
4595300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7170e7a3393bcd0fd22f06edb5408d2ebbb1d8d1 OP_EQUAL
address
MJEyqsZ9swBN5QEsaSoZH1iQhRcuqKpb2x
transaction
3098c8805946598bcf280e68434cd9c2d554d85455edb789089fa8211d0e028a
spent
true